Ngokusho kweNASA ngoJuni 10 isikhathi sendawo, Idatha ye-CST-100 “Inkanyezi” epakwe e-International Space Station ibe nokunye ukuvuza kwe-helium. Lokhu bekuwukuputshuka kwesihlanu ngemuva kokwethulwa, futhi isikhathi sokubuya sasidinga ukubambezeleka.
NgoJuni 6, I-Boeing CST-100 “Inkanyezi” wasondela esiteshini se-International Spaceport ngesikhathi sokuhlolwa kwendiza eyenziwe ngabantu.
Kusuka ku-Boeing 787 “I-Dreamliner” ku-CST-100 “Inkanyezi,” kuletha okulindelwe yi-Boeing kuzo zombili izimboni ezibalulekile zezindiza kanye ne-aerospace ekhulwini lama-21: ukuthumela abantu esibhakabhakeni bese kuba ngaphandle komkhathi. Ngeshwa, kusuka kumlilo webhethri we-lithium we “I-Dreamliner” ekuvuzeni kwe “Inkanyezi,” kube nezindaba eziningi zobuchwepheshe nezekhwalithi ephezulu, okubonakala kukhombisa ukungakwazi kwe-Boeing njengesikhungo sokukhiqiza esineminyaka eyikhulu ubudala.

I-Thermal splashing innovation idlala umsebenzi obalulekile emkhakheni we-aerospace
Indawo yokuqinisa nokuphepha: Izimoto zasemkhathini kanye nezinjini zazo zisebenza ngaphansi kwezimo ezinzima futhi zidinga ukubhekana nobunzima obuningi njengokushisa, umfutho ophezulu, i-broadband, ukugqwala, nokusebenzisa. Ubuchwepheshe besimanje bokufutha okushisayo bungathuthukisa kakhulu impilo yesevisi kanye nobuqotho bezinto ezibalulekile ngokulungiselela izendlalelo ezisebenza ngezinto eziningi ezifana nokungagugi., ukumelana nokugqwala kanye ne-anti-oxidation ebusweni balezi zakhi. Ngokwesibonelo, emva kokufafaza okushisayo, izinto zendawo ezinezinga lokushisa eliphezulu njengama-turbine blades nezinjini ezivuthayo zezinjini zendiza zingamelana namazinga okushisa aphezulu okusebenza, ukunciphisa izindleko zokunakekela, futhi andise impilo yonke yesevisi yenjini.
Ukunakekela kanye nokukhiqiza kabusha: Izindleko zokugcina zemishini yasemkhathini ziphezulu, kanye ne-thermal splashing ubuchwepheshe besimanje bungakwazi ukulungisa ngokushesha izingxenye ezigugile noma ezilimele, njengokulungisa ama-blade onqenqemeni kanye nokusetshenziswa kabusha kwezimbobo zangaphakathi zenjini, ukunciphisa isidingo sokushintsha ukulungisa nokonga isikhathi nezindleko. Phezu kwalokho, isifutho esishisayo siphinde sisekele ukuthuthukiswa kokusebenza kwezingxenye ezindala futhi siqonde ukukhiqiza kabusha okusebenzayo.
Isitayela esinesisindo esincane: Ngokufafaza okushisayo kokuqedwa kokusebenza okuphezulu kuma-substratum anesisindo esincane, izinto zokwakha zinganikezwa amakhaya emishini eyengeziwe noma izici eziyingqayizivele, njenge-conductivity kanye nokufudumala kokushisa, ngaphandle kokufaka isisindo esiningi kakhulu, ehlangabezana nezidingo ezisheshayo zenkundla ye-aerospace yokunciphisa isisindo kanye nenhlanganisela yemisebenzi eminingi.
Intuthuko entsha yezinto ezibonakalayo: Ngokukhula kobuchwepheshe be-aerospace, izidingo zokusebenza komkhiqizo ziyakhula. I-Thermal spraying innovation ingaguqula izinto ezijwayelekile zibe izembozo ezinamakhaya amanoveli, njengokuqedwa kwe-gradient, Izembozo ze-nanocomposite, njalo njalo, ekhangisa ukuthuthuka kocwaningo kanye nokusetshenziswa kwezinto ezintsha sha.
Ukuguqulwa nokuzivumelanisa nezimo: Indawo ye-aerospace inezidingo eziqinile kubukhulu, ifomu kanye nomsebenzi wezingxenye. Ukuguquguquka kobuchwepheshe besimanje bokufutha ngokushisa kuvumela ukunamathela ukuthi kwenziwe ngokwezidingo zemininingwane, kungakhathaliseki ukuthi i-geometry eyinkimbinkimbi noma izidingo zokusebenza ezikhethekile, okungafezwa ngokulawula ngokunembile ukushuba kokumboza, isakhiwo, kanye nesakhiwo.

Ukusetshenziswa kwe-tungsten powder eyindilinga kubuchwepheshe bokufafaza okushisayo kubangelwa ikakhulukazi izici zayo zomzimba namakhemikhali ezihlukile..
Ukumboza ukuvumelana nokuqina: Impushana ye-tungsten eyindilinga inoketshezi olukhulu futhi ingaphezulu kwemininingwane encishisiwe, okwenza kube lula ukuthi impushana isakazwe ngendlela efanayo futhi incibilike ngesikhathi senqubo yokufafaza okushisayo, ngakho-ke kwakheka ungqimba olufana kakhulu noluminyene endaweni engaphansi. Lokhu kuqedwa kunganikeza ukumelana okungcono kakhulu kokugqoka, ukumelana nokuwohloka, kanye nokumelana nezinga lokushisa eliphezulu, okubalulekile ezingxenyeni ezibalulekile ze-aerospace, amandla, kanye nezimakethe zamakhemikhali.
Khulisa ukusebenza kokuqeda: Ukusetshenziswa kwe-spherical tungsten powder ekufutheni okushisayo kungakhuphula kakhulu ukuqina kwesibopho, gqoka ukumelana, kanye nokumelana nokushisa okuphezulu kwesembozo. Lezi zinzuzo ze-tungsten powder eyindilinga zibaluleke kakhulu ekwenziweni kokuqedwa kwegumbi elivuthayo, izinga lokushisa eliphezulu elivikela ukugqokwa kwengxenye, nezinye izinhlelo zokusebenza ngenxa yokuthi lezi zingxenye zisebenza ezindaweni ezinzima futhi zinezidingo zokusebenza okuphezulu kakhulu.
Yehlisa i-porosity: Uma kuqhathaniswa nezimpushana ezinomumo ongajwayelekile, izimpushana eziyindilinga kungenzeka kakhulu ukunciphisa ukwakheka kwezimbotshana ngesikhathi sokunqwabelanisa nokuncibilika, okubaluleke kakhulu kumaqediyo adinga ukuvalwa okuphezulu noma ukungena okonakele.
Ifanele uhla lobuchwepheshe besimanje bokuchaphaza okushisayo: Noma ngabe ukufutha umlilo, ukufafaza kwe-arc, ukufafaza nge-plasma, noma i-high-velocity oxygen-fuel thermal splashing (I-HVOF), i-spherical tungsten powder ingakwazi ukuzivumelanisa kahle futhi ibonise ukuhambisana okuhle kakhulu kwenqubo, okwenza kube lula ukukhetha i-splashing emisha efanelekile kakhulu ngokuya ngezidingo ezahlukahlukene.
Izinhlelo zokusebenza ezihlukile: Kwezinye izindawo eziyingqayizivele, njengokwakhiwa kwama-alloys asezingeni eliphezulu, Izembozo ezilungiselelwe nge-plasma eshisayo, nokuphrinta kwe-3D, i-spherical tungsten powder ibuye isetshenziswe njengesigaba sokusekela noma yenza ngokuqondile ingxenye yohlaka oluyinkimbinkimbi., eyengeziwe ekhulisa ukusetshenziswa kwayo okuhlukahlukene.
